Adolf Dragičević

"Fundamentals of Political Economy" (1989) by Adolf Dragičević is a book that systematically presents the basic concepts and principles of political economy, with an emphasis on the then dominant Marxist approach.

Dragičević explains how economic relations arise from social relations and how they change throughout history. He places special emphasis on the critique of the capitalist system, pointing out inequalities and cyclical crises, and on the theoretical foundations of socialist economics. The book is written as a clear and didactic introduction, intended for students and anyone who wants to understand the basic concepts of political economy. In short, it is a basic manual that provides insight into economic theories and their application in the social context of the late 20th century.
